]> git.sesse.net Git - kdenlive/blobdiff - src/colorcorrection/waveformgenerator.cpp
Mouse tracking re-enabled for the vectorscope (got lost previously). Build warning...
[kdenlive] / src / colorcorrection / waveformgenerator.cpp
index f1ea311509857420fcedcda9dee98eb08b7f304b..971471e711a59b630a655ee859bca599f6993554 100644 (file)
@@ -33,8 +33,8 @@ QImage WaveformGenerator::calculateWaveform(const QSize &waveformSize, const QIm
 {
     Q_ASSERT(accelFactor >= 1);
 
-    QTime time;
-    time.start();
+    //QTime time;
+    //time.start();
 
     QImage wave(waveformSize, QImage::Format_ARGB32);
 
@@ -76,11 +76,10 @@ QImage WaveformGenerator::calculateWaveform(const QSize &waveformSize, const QIm
         const float wPrediv = (float)(ww-1)/(iw-1);
 
         const uchar *bits = image.bits();
-        const uchar *bitsStart = bits;
 
         for (uint i = 0, x = 0; i < byteCount; i += 4) {
 
-            Q_ASSERT(bits < bitsStart + byteCount);
+            Q_ASSERT(bits < image.bits() + byteCount);
 
             col = (QRgb *)bits;
 
@@ -153,8 +152,8 @@ QImage WaveformGenerator::calculateWaveform(const QSize &waveformSize, const QIm
 
     }
 
-    uint diff = time.elapsed();
-    emit signalCalculationFinished(wave, diff);
+    //uint diff = time.elapsed();
+    //emit signalCalculationFinished(wave, diff);
 
     return wave;
 }